"Say no more on that head," exclaimed Gay hastily, "I would forget that affront."
"But not forgive. We're all of us free to carry the battle into the enemy's camp and with the more vigour since you are fighting with us, John Gay. The 'Beggar's Opera'—'tis mainly the Dean's idea—the title alone is vastly fine—will give you all the chance in the world. Pray do not forget the Dean's verses he sent you 't'other day. They must be set to good music, though for my own part I know not one tune from another."
Snatching a sheet of paper from the table Pope, in his thin, piping voice, read with much gusto:—
"Through all the employments of life
Each neighbour abuses his brother,
Trull and rogue they call husband and wife,
All professions be-rogue one another.
"The priest calls the lawyer a cheat,
The lawyer be-knaves the divine,
And the statesman because he's so great
